CUHP VC presents key outcome paper at VCs’ conference in Gujarat

Dharamshala, July 11 (UNI) Prof. S.P. Bansal, Vice Chancellor of the Central University of Himachal Pradesh (CUHP), coordinated a key session on “Internationalization of Higher Education in India” during the Vice Chancellors’ Conference which concluded today in Kevadia, Gujarat.
The event was organized by the Ministry of Education to chalk out a roadmap for implementing the National Education Policy (NEP) 2020.
In a statement issued here today by the Central University Himachal Pradesh, said that Prof. Bansal led a group comprising premier institutions like JNU, South Asian University, and University of Allahabad, and presented an outcome paper highlighting strategies to attract foreign students and globalize Indian higher education.
